Ingredients
– 2 lbs boneless, skinless chicken breasts, cut into 1-inch cubes
– ½ cup ranch dressing
– 3 cloves garlic, minced
– ½ cup grated Parmesan cheese
– ½ teaspoon black pepper
– ½ teaspoon onion powder
– 1 tablespoon olive oil
– Wooden or metal skewers (if using wooden skewers, soak them in water for 30 minutes prior to grilling)
Instructions
Making Grilled Ranch Garlic Parmesan Chicken Skewers is a straightforward process. Follow these easy steps for success:
1. Prepare Marinade: In a large bowl, combine ranch dressing, minced garlic, Parmesan cheese, black pepper, onion powder, and olive oil.
2. Add Chicken: Add the cubed chicken to the marinade, ensuring each piece is well coated.
3. Marinate: Cover the bowl with plastic wrap and let it marinate in the refrigerator for 15-30 minutes. This enhances the flavors.
4. Preheat Grill: As the chicken marinates, preheat your grill to medium-high heat.
5. Skewer Chicken: Once marinated, thread the chicken pieces onto skewers, leaving a little space between each piece for even cooking.
6. Grill Skewers: Place the skewers on the preheated grill. Cook for about 10-15 minutes, turning occasionally until the chicken is cooked through and has nice grill marks. An internal temperature of 165°F (75°C) should be your target.
7. Remove and Serve: Once cooked, remove the skewers from the grill and let them rest for a few minutes before serving.

-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 10-15 minutes
Nutrition
- Serving Size: 6
- Calories: 380 kcal
- Fat: 25g
- Protein: 35g
